Direct answer and formula

6 3/8 inches is 161.925 mm exactly because the international inch is exactly 25.4 mm.

6 3/8 × 25.4 = 161.925 mm

Basis: 1 inch = 25.4 mm exactly (international inch definition)

Rounding, fractions, and tolerance

The converted value 161.925 mm is exact. To one decimal it is 161.9 mm; the nearest 0.5 mm is 162 mm (difference 0.075 mm), and the nearest whole millimeter is 162 mm (difference 0.075 mm). Rounded metric sizes are not interchangeable unless that difference fits the tolerance budget.

A nearby rounded size is acceptable only when its absolute difference is within the documented dimensional tolerance and all non-dimensional compatibility checks pass.

Editorial measurement check

If the value came from a drawing, carry its tolerance and revision context alongside the converted unit.

Compare the smallest permitted opening with the largest permitted component whenever clearance, rather than center value, controls the decision.

Review cumulative error at the farthest feature or edge, where small rounding choices become easiest to detect.

Nearby comparison and substitution boundary

Nearest-0.5-mm rounding maps exact results from 161.75 mm up to (but not including) 162.25 mm to 162 mm with half-up ties. Using 162 mm as a physical substitute changes this dimension by 0.075 mm; verify fit, thread, clearance, or process allowance as applicable.

Candidate: 162 mm; absolute difference: 0.075 mm.
